Our District Managers are an integral part of the organization. Responsible for managing millions of dollars and providing hands-on leadership to their own districts, our district managers have the chance to make a true impact on our company. Key responsibilities included running up to five stores within a designated district, leading store personnel and making decisions to drive business results.

District Managers begin their ALDI career by completing a thorough year-long training program. The program is a hands-on learning experience that immerses new hires in the day-to-day operations of ALDI and exposes them to the entire business. While in training you will work closely with a peer advisor and executives throughout the division.
